More about first aid courses in Sunbury
If you're looking to enhance your skills and qualifications in the vital field of first aid, Sunbury offers a variety of courses that cater to beginners and professionals alike. With 14 first aid courses available, you can find the appropriate training to suit your needs, whether you're interested in obtaining a Provide First Aid HLTAID011 certificate or learning how to Provide Basic Emergency Life Support HLTAID010. Training in Sunbury is delivered by recognised Registered Training Organisations (RTOs) ensuring you receive quality education and qualifications that are respected across various industries.
The Assist Clients with Medication HLTHPS006 course is an excellent choice for those aiming to support clients with their medication needs, while the Certificate II in Medical Service First Response HLT21020 is perfect for anyone wanting a more comprehensive foundation in medical services. Furthermore, roles such as First Aid Officers and Occupational Health and Safety Advisors greatly benefit from these certifications, boosting their employability in local organisations.
In addition to these certifications, Sunbury also offers courses such as the Certificate III in Basic Health Care HLT31220 and Provide Advanced Resuscitation and Oxygen Therapy HLTAID015, both paving the way for career advancements in health care settings. Completing programs like the Occupational First Aid Skill Set HLTSS00068 will not only enhance your skill set but also prepare you for critical job roles in emergency response.
For those interested in maintaining high standards of hygiene and safety, courses on infection prevention such as the Comply with Infection Prevention and Control Policies and Procedures HLTINFCOV001 and the Infection Prevention and Control Skill Set HLTSS00083 can be invaluable. With First Aid certifications in Sunbury, you can boost your confidence and job readiness for critical roles in various sectors, ensuring you're prepared to provide help when it matters most.
